Here is a detail that surprises most players: although you have not been able to fund a gambling account with a credit card in Great Britain since April 2020, plenty of UKGC-licensed casinos still make the card experience feel central to their brand. The reason is simple. While credit cards are banned, debit cards from Visa and Mastercard remain the single most popular deposit method in the country, and the checkout experience is practically identical. The Terms That Decide Real Value
Here is the uncomfortable truth about casino bonuses: the headline figure is almost never the full story. Two casinos can both offer a £100 welcome bonus, but one might be genuinely valuable while the other is a trap. The difference lies entirely in the terms. Wagering requirements are set by individual operators and commonly range from about 20x to 65x; they are commercial terms, not law. We compared the actual terms at each of our six ranked casinos so you can see the difference for yourself.
| Term | What It Means For You |
|---|---|
| Wagering requirement | The number of times you must bet the bonus amount before you can withdraw. A £100 bonus at 35x requires £3,500 of total bets. |
| Game contribution | Slots usually count 100% toward wagering, but table games often count only 10-20%. Check before you play. |
| Time limit | Most bonuses expire after 7-30 days. If you do not clear the wagering in time, the bonus and any winnings vanish. |
| Max bet while wagering | Many casinos cap your stake at £5 per spin while clearing a bonus. Exceed it and you void the bonus. |
| Withdrawal method | Some casinos only pay back to the original deposit card. Others offer e-wallet or bank transfer alternatives. |
Let us work through a concrete example to show how this plays out. Suppose a casino offers a £50 welcome bonus with a 35x wagering requirement. The total you must stake is £50 multiplied by 35, which comes to £1,750. If the casino’s slots all contribute 100% toward this, you can clear it by playing slots alone. But if you prefer blackjack, and blackjack only counts 10% toward the requirement, you would need to stake £17,500 in blackjack to clear the same bonus. That is the difference between a reasonable offer and an impossible one.

Is it true that credit cards are completely banned?
Yes, since April 2020 it has been illegal for UK gambling operators to accept credit card deposits. The casinos in this article all accept debit cards instead, which offer the same convenience without the debt risk. If you see a casino claiming to accept credit cards, it is not licensed by the UKGC and you should avoid it entirely.
